    <title>Word &quot;same&quot;</title>
    <link>https://www.taxtmi.com/manuals?id=6734</link>
    <description>The word same can denote either exact identity or membership of the same kind depending on context; Black&#039;s Law Dictionary notes it may mean identical, equal, or equivalent but often signifies the same kind rather than the specific thing, and when preceded by the definite article ordinarily refers to the one previously mentioned.</description>
